Pokémon Center Yokohama Satellite
The Pokémon Company has announced a new kind of Pokémon Center location, scheduled to open on April 9th in Yokohama. The new location is dubbed Pokémon Center Yokohama Satellite, and functions as a smaller branch to Yokohama’s regular Pokémon Center, which is located just a six minute walk away. This new satellite location will be in the Joinus shopping center, just outside the west exit of the Yokohama train station.

Pokémon Center Yokohama Satellite will be smaller than a normal Pokémon Center, with a more limited selection of merchandise. The store is not a pop-up but a permanent location. It will feature a large screen where visitors can see Pokémon information, Pokémon videos, and, occasionally, a Pokémon reporting the weather of the day.

Notably, the Joinus shopping center offers tax-free shopping services for tourists. Tax-free shopping policies vary between Pokémon Center locations in Japan, and the main Pokémon Center Yokohama does not offer tax-free shopping at all. Neither Joinus nor The Pokémon Company have clarified yet what Pokémon Center Yokohama Satellite’s tax-free shopping policies will be.
